About KBG30ZMV256G

The TOSHIBA KBG30ZMV256G is a 256GB NVMe solid-state drive (SSD) specifically designed to deliver high performance in modern computing devices such as ultrabooks, thin laptops and space-constrained systems. Sporting an M.2 2280 form factor, this SSD offers an ideal combination of high speed and compact design, making it an excellent choice for users who require fast storage without sacrificing physical space within the device.

It is built with a PCIe Gen3 x2 interface and supports the NVMe 1.3 protocol, which is significantly faster than traditional SATA-based SSDs. Thanks to 3D NAND flash technology, the TOSHIBA KBG30ZMV256G is able to deliver consistent performance and better power efficiency, while extending the lifetime and reliability of the device. This technology also contributes to low power consumption, which is especially important for laptops and mobile devices that rely on battery efficiency.

In tests conducted using a ThinkPad T470 with an Intel Core i5-6300U processor, 8GB of RAM, and Windows 10 22H2 operating system, this SSD performed very well for a variety of daily computing needs. Based on the CrystalDiskMark benchmark, read speeds reached 774.69 MB/s and write speeds of 401.20 MB/s. Tests with the ATTO Disk Benchmark showed read speeds of up to 1000 MB/s and 589.86 MB/s write, while in the AS-SSD Benchmark, read speeds jumped to 1363.84 MB/s and 786.62 MB/s write. These results show that the SSD is capable of handling demanding tasks such as fast booting, large application loads and large file transfers very efficiently.
